+//-----------------------------------------------------------------------------
+// MessagePumpForUI extends MessagePumpWin with methods that are particular to a
+// MessageLoop instantiated with TYPE_UI.
+//
+class MessagePumpForUI : public MessagePumpWin {
+ public:
+ MessagePumpForUI() {}
+ virtual ~MessagePumpForUI() {}
+ private:
+ virtual void DoRunLoop();
+ void WaitForWork();
+};
+
+//-----------------------------------------------------------------------------
+// MessagePumpForIO extends MessagePumpWin with methods that are particular to a
+// MessageLoop instantiated with TYPE_IO.
+//
+class MessagePumpForIO : public MessagePumpWin {
+ public:
+ // Used with WatchObject to asynchronously monitor the signaled state of a
+ // HANDLE object.
+ class Watcher {
+ public:
+ virtual ~Watcher() {}
+ // Called from MessageLoop::Run when a signalled object is detected.
+ virtual void OnObjectSignaled(HANDLE object) = 0;
+ };
+
+ MessagePumpForIO() {}
+ virtual ~MessagePumpForIO() {}
+
+ // Have the current thread's message loop watch for a signaled object.
+ // Pass a null watcher to stop watching the object.
+ void WatchObject(HANDLE, Watcher*);
+
+ private:
+ virtual void DoRunLoop();
+ void WaitForWork();
+ bool ProcessNextObject();
+ bool SignalWatcher(size_t object_index);
+
+ // A vector of objects (and corresponding watchers) that are routinely
+ // serviced by this message pump.
+ std::vector<HANDLE> objects_;
+ std::vector<Watcher*> watchers_;
+};
+
